Lucia Zrate is based on the poignant, real-life odyssey of the world's smallest woman. Pretty and gregarious, Lucia Zrate was just twenty inches tall. A celebrity after her 'display' at the 1876 Philadelphia Centennial International Exhibition, Lucia's extraordinary, heartbreaking story is one of exploitation by greedy sideshow hucksters and a fishbowl existence on the road, from New York to Victorian London. We follow the adventures of diminutive Lucia Zrate and her devoted governess as they grapple with life and death, finding joy and adventure in their bumpy sideshow journey of more than fourteen years. This is an artfully balanced novel that is a mesmerizing tale of survival, resilience, and the uplifting force of friendship.
